RIP Prabhudo
>> Sad news. Prabuddha Dasgupta, the shy and self-effacing Goa-based highly regarded photographer passed away suddenly over the weekend. Dasgupta whose career blossomed simultaneously with that of India’s fashion genesis will be sorely missed. We recall how highly aesthetes like Tarun Tahiliani regarded his work especially his books like Women (Viking Books), an aesthetically superb collection of portraits and nudes of urban Indian women, Ladakh (Viking Books),) India Now — New Photographic Visions (Textuel, Paris) and Edge of Faith (Seagull Books).

“He had a heart attack in a taxi en route to the airport from Alibaug while catching a fight to Bangalore,” scenographer Sumant Jaikrishnan informs us. What is particularly tragic is that Prabhudo was alone in the taxi with Laxmi, the international model who is his partner and muse. The trauma they must have experienced is unimaginable.

Prabuddha Dasgupta
Prabuddha Dasgupta

The news has left the fashion frat reeling. Rohit Bal who was a friend and collaborator of the talented photographer says, “This terrible tragedy has left is all in deep shock and disbelief.” RIP Prabhudo, and thank you for all the startlingly beautiful images you gave
